    Quote by Snipermaxim1900 View Post
    Hey, I did saw a stamp on the split pins, maybe if I’d remove and take a closer look I could possibly found out the maker.
    If they are marked then probably wartime, although as Danmark has stated not original to this particular lid. It's not easy to tell if the outer surface of these pins is painted or showing similar corrosion to the shells outer surface.

    For all this I like it, as its named as well, looks like "Rudi" and perhaps had his Feldpost number on the side. A true relic.
